Transition from Crypt2.GetSignerCertChain to Crypt2.LastSignerCert

Provides instructions for replacing deprecated GetSignerCertChain method calls with LastSignerCert.

uses
    Winapi.Windows, Winapi.Messages, System.SysUtils, System.Variants, System.Classes, Vcl.Graphics,
    Vcl.Controls, Vcl.Forms, Vcl.Dialogs, Vcl.StdCtrls, Chilkat_TLB;

...

procedure TForm1.Button1Click(Sender: TObject);
var
success: Integer;
crypt2: TChilkatCrypt2;
index: Integer;
certchainObj: IChilkatCertChain;
signerCert: TChilkatCert;
certChain: TChilkatCertChain;

begin
success := 0;

crypt2 := TChilkatCrypt2.Create(Self);

// ...
// ...
index := 0;

// ------------------------------------------------------------------------
// The GetSignerCertChain method is deprecated:

certchainObj := crypt2.GetSignerCertChain(index);
if (crypt2.LastMethodSuccess = 0) then
  begin
    Memo1.Lines.Add(crypt2.LastErrorText);
    Exit;
  end;

// ...
// ...

// ------------------------------------------------------------------------
// Do the equivalent using LastSignerCert, and then get the certificate chain from the cert.
// Your application creates a new, empty Cert object which is passed 
// in the last argument and filled upon success.

signerCert := TChilkatCert.Create(Self);
success := crypt2.LastSignerCert(index,signerCert.ControlInterface);
if (success = 0) then
  begin
    Memo1.Lines.Add(crypt2.LastErrorText);
    Exit;
  end;

certChain := TChilkatCertChain.Create(Self);
success := signerCert.BuildCertChain(certChain.ControlInterface);
if (success = 0) then
  begin
    Memo1.Lines.Add(signerCert.LastErrorText);
    Exit;
  end;
end;
